Understanding Sinus Infections
Before exploring the remedies, it’s crucial to understand the causes and symptoms of sinus infections. Sinusitis is the medical term for a sinus infection, which can be caused by a viral, bacterial, or fungal infection. The condition can be classified into two main categories: acute and chronic. Acute sinusitis is a short-term infection that lasts up to four weeks, while chronic sinusitis is a long-term condition that persists for more than 12 weeks.
Symptoms of Sinus Infections
The symptoms of a sinus infection can vary depending on the severity and type of infection. Common symptoms include:
Sinus pressure and pain
Congestion and stuffiness
Yellow or green nasal discharge
Coughing and sneezing
Headache and facial pain
Fatigue and weakness
Loss of smell and taste

How can I use a neti pot to get rid of a sinus infection, and is it safe?
Using a neti pot can be an effective way to rinse out the nasal passages and sinuses, helping to remove excess mucus and debris that can contribute to a sinus infection. To use a neti pot, individuals should fill it with a saline solution, tilt their head to one side, and pour the solution into the top nostril, allowing it to flow out the other nostril. The process should be repeated on the other side. It’s essential to use sterile or distilled water and to rinse the neti pot thoroughly after each use to prevent the growth of bacteria and other microorganisms.
When used properly, a neti pot can be a safe and effective tool for managing sinus infections. However, it’s crucial to follow proper safety precautions to avoid complications. Individuals should always use sterile or distilled water, and never use tap water, which can contain harmful microorganisms. Additionally, the neti pot should be cleaned and dried thoroughly after each use, and individuals should avoid sharing the device with others. By following these precautions and using the neti pot as directed, individuals can help to alleviate their symptoms and promote recovery from a sinus infection.

Can antibiotics help get rid of a sinus infection, and when are they necessary?
Antibiotics can be effective in treating sinus infections that are caused by bacterial infections. However, they are not always necessary, and their use should be determined by a healthcare professional. In general, antibiotics are recommended for sinus infections that are severe, persistent, or caused by a bacterial infection. Individuals who have a fever, facial pain, or thick yellow or green nasal discharge may be candidates for antibiotic treatment. Additionally, those who have a weakened immune system or underlying health conditions may also require antibiotics to prevent complications.
It’s essential to note that antibiotics should only be used when necessary, as overuse or misuse can lead to antibiotic resistance and other complications. Individuals should always consult a healthcare professional for a proper diagnosis and treatment plan, and should not self-medicate with antibiotics. How long does it take to recover from a sinus infection, and what are some tips for a speedy recovery?
The length of time it takes to recover from a sinus infection can vary depending on the severity of the infection, the effectiveness of treatment, and the individual’s overall health. In general, mild sinus infections can resolve on their own within 7-10 days, while more severe infections may take several weeks to recover from. To promote a speedy recovery, individuals should prioritize rest, stay hydrated, and use saline nasal sprays or drops to moisturize the nasal passages. Additionally, using a humidifier, avoiding allergens and irritants, and managing stress can also help to alleviate symptoms and support the body’s natural healing processes.
To further support recovery, individuals can also try to elevate their head while sleeping, use eucalyptus oil or menthol to loosen mucus, and avoid blowing their nose too hard, which can push mucus further into the sinuses.
